What is a senior panel designer?

Senior Panel Designers are experienced professionals who design, develop, and oversee the creation of electrical control panels used in various industrial and commercial applications. They are responsible for creating detailed panel layouts, wiring diagrams, and ensuring that the designs comply with industry standards and client specifications. Senior Panel Designers often collaborate with engineers, project managers, and manufacturing teams to deliver efficient and safe control systems. Their expertise is crucial in ensuring the reliability and functionality of automated processes.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a senior panel designer,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Senior Panel Designer, you need strong expertise in electrical engineering principles, panel design standards, and experience with schematic and layout creation, often supported by a relevant engineering degree or technical certification. Proficiency with CAD software such as AutoCAD Electrical or EPLAN, as well as familiarity with industry codes and PLC integration, is typically required. Attention to detail, problem-solving skills, and effective communication with multidisciplinary teams distinguish top performers in this role. These skills are crucial to ensure accurate, safe, and efficient panel designs that meet client specifications and regulatory requirements.

What are some common challenges a senior panel designer faces in coordinating with cross-functional teams during a project?

Senior Panel Designers often work closely with engineers, project managers, and production teams to ensure panel layouts meet technical requirements and industry standards. A common challenge is balancing differing priorities, such as design specifications versus manufacturing capabilities or project timelines. Effective communication, early involvement in project planning, and a proactive approach to problem-solving are essential for navigating these challenges and delivering successful outcomes.
